Best Data Removal Services 2026

Data removal services scan data broker sites for your personal information and submit opt-out requests on your behalf. With hundreds of people-search sites exposing home addresses, phone numbers, and family details, these services automate a process that would take dozens of hours to do manually.

02 Do data removal services actually work?

Yes. Data removal services automate the opt-out process that you could do manually. They submit removal requests to data brokers and monitor for re-listings. Results typically take 1-4 weeks per broker, and some brokers may re-list your data, which is why ongoing monitoring matters.
